Exemplo n.º 1
0
 def __init__(self, ownerDoc, x= None, y= None):
     BaseEditableTextNode.__init__(self, ownerDoc, 'tspan')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self._allowedSvgChildNodes.update({self.SVG_A_NODE, self.SVG_ALT_GLYPH_NODE, self.SVG_ANIMATE_NODE, self.SVG_ANIMATE_COLOR_NODE,
                                        self.SVG_SET_NODE, self.SVG_TREF_NODE, self.SVG_TSPAN_NODE})
Exemplo n.º 2
0
 def __init__(self, ownerDoc, x=None, y=None, z=None):
     BasicSvgNode.__init__(self, ownerDoc, 'fePointLight')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setZ(z)
     self._allowedSvgChildNodes.update({self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 3
0
 def __init__(self, ownerDoc, x=None, y=None):
     BasicSvgNode.__init__(self, ownerDoc, 'cursor')
     ConditionalProcessingA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self._allowedSvgChildNodes.update(self.SVG_GROUP_DESCRIPTIVE_ELEMENTS)
Exemplo n.º 4
0
 def __init__(self, ownerDoc, x=None, y=None, height=None, width=None):
     BaseShapeNode.__init__(self, ownerDoc, 'rect')
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setHeight(height)
     self.setWidth(width)
Exemplo n.º 5
0
 def __init__(self, ownerDoc, x=None, y=None):
     BasicSvgNode.__init__(self, ownerDoc, 'cursor')
     ConditionalProcessingA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self._allowedSvgChildNodes.update(self.SVG_GROUP_DESCRIPTIVE_ELEMENTS)
Exemplo n.º 6
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'glyphRef')
     PresentationA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     self._allowedSvgChildNodes.update({self.SVG_GLYPH_REF_NODE, self.SVG_ALT_GLYPH_ITEM_NODE})
Exemplo n.º 7
0
 def __init__(self, ownerDoc, x=None, y=None, z=None):
     BasicSvgNode.__init__(self, ownerDoc, 'fePointLight')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setZ(z)
     self._allowedSvgChildNodes.update(
         {self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 8
0
 def __init__(self, ownerDoc, x=None, y=None, height=None, width=None):
     BaseShapeNode.__init__(self, ownerDoc, "rect")
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setHeight(height)
     self.setWidth(width)
Exemplo n.º 9
0
 def __init__(self, ownerDoc, x=None, y=None, z=None, specularExponent=None, limitingConeAngle=None):
     BasicSvgNode.__init__(self, ownerDoc, 'feSpotLight')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setZ(z)
     self.setSpecularExponent(specularExponent)
     self.setLimitingConeAngle(limitingConeAngle)
     self._allowedSvgChildNodes.update({self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 10
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'foreignObject')
     ConditionalProcessingAttributes.__init__(self)
     GraphicalEventAttributes.__init__(self)
     PresentationA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     self.allowAllSvgNodesAsChildNodes= True
Exemplo n.º 11
0
 def __init__(self, ownerDoc, x=None, y=None):
     BaseEditableTextNode.__init__(self, ownerDoc, 'tspan')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self._allowedSvgChildNodes.update({
         self.SVG_A_NODE, self.SVG_ALT_GLYPH_NODE, self.SVG_ANIMATE_NODE,
         self.SVG_ANIMATE_COLOR_NODE, self.SVG_SET_NODE, self.SVG_TREF_NODE,
         self.SVG_TSPAN_NODE
     })
Exemplo n.º 12
0
 def __init__(self, ownerDoc, x= None, y= None, text= None):
     BaseEditableTextNode.__init__(self, ownerDoc, 'text')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setText(text)
     #add groups
     self._allowedSvgChildNodes.update(self.SVG_GROUP_ANIMATION_ELEMENTS, self.SVG_GROUP_TEXT_CONTENT_CHILD_ELEMENTS)
     #add individual nodes
     self._allowedSvgChildNodes.add(self.SVG_A_NODE)
Exemplo n.º 13
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'foreignObject')
     ConditionalProcessingAttributes.__init__(self)
     GraphicalEventAttributes.__init__(self)
     PresentationA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     self.allowAllSvgNodesAsChildNodes = True
Exemplo n.º 14
0
 def __init__(self, ownerDoc, x=None, y=None, text=None):
     BaseEditableTextNode.__init__(self, ownerDoc, 'text')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setText(text)
     #add groups
     self._allowedSvgChildNodes.update(self.SVG_GROUP_ANIMATION_ELEMENTS, self.SVG_GROUP_TEXT_CONTENT_CHILD_ELEMENTS)
     #add individual nodes
     self._allowedSvgChildNodes.add(self.SVG_A_NODE)
Exemplo n.º 15
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'image')
     ConditionalProcessingAttributes.__init__(self)
     GraphicalEventA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     PresentationA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     self._allowedSvgChildNodes.update(self.SVG_GROUP_ANIMATION_ELEMENTS, self.SVG_GROUP_DESCRIPTIVE_ELEMENTS)
Exemplo n.º 16
0
 def __init__(self, ownerDoc):
     BaseContainerNode.__init__(self, ownerDoc, 'pattern')
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     ConditionalProcessingA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     #add groups
     self._allowedSvgChildNodes.update(self.SVG_GROUP_ANIMATION_ELEMENTS, self.SVG_GROUP_DESCRIPTIVE_ELEMENTS, self.SVG_GROUP_SHAPE_ELEMENTS, self.SVG_GROUP_STRUCTURAL_ELEMENTS, self.SVG_GROUP_GRADIENT_ELEMENTS)
     #add indivudual elements
     self._allowedSvgChildNodes.update({self.SVG_A_NODE, self.SVG_ALT_GLYPH_DEF_NODE, self.SVG_CLIP_PATH_NODE, self.SVG_COLOR_PROFILE_NODE, self.SVG_CURSOR_NODE, self.SVG_FILTER_NODE, self.SVG_FONT_NODE,
                                        self.SVG_FONT_FACE_NODE, self.SVG_FOREIGN_OBJECT_NODE, self.SVG_IMAGE_NODE, self.SVG_MARKER_NODE, self.SVG_MASK_NODE, self.SVG_PATTERN_NODE, self.SVG_SCRIPT_NODE,
                                        self.SVG_STYLE_NODE, self.SVG_SWITCH_NODE, self.SVG_TEXT_NODE, self.SVG_VIEW_NODE})        
Exemplo n.º 17
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'filter')
     PresentationA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     #add groups
     self._allowedSvgChildNodes.update(self.SVG_GROUP_DESCRIPTIVE_ELEMENTS, self.SVG_GROUP_FILTER_PRIMITIVE_ELEMENTS)
     #add individual nodes
     self._allowedSvgChildNodes.update({self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 18
0
 def __init__(self, ownerDoc):
     BasicSvgNode.__init__(self, ownerDoc, 'filter')
     PresentationAttributes.__init__(self)
     XlinkAttributes.__init__(self)
     ClassAttribute.__init__(self)
     StyleA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     #add groups
     self._allowedSvgChildNodes.update(
         self.SVG_GROUP_DESCRIPTIVE_ELEMENTS,
         self.SVG_GROUP_FILTER_PRIMITIVE_ELEMENTS)
     #add individual nodes
     self._allowedSvgChildNodes.update(
         {self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 19
0
 def __init__(self,
              ownerDoc,
              x=None,
              y=None,
              z=None,
              specularExponent=None,
              limitingConeAngle=None):
     BasicSvgNode.__init__(self, ownerDoc, 'feSpotLight')
     PositionAttributes.__init__(self)
     self.setX(x)
     self.setY(y)
     self.setZ(z)
     self.setSpecularExponent(specularExponent)
     self.setLimitingConeAngle(limitingConeAngle)
     self._allowedSvgChildNodes.update(
         {self.SVG_ANIMATE_NODE, self.SVG_SET_NODE})
Exemplo n.º 20
0
 def __init__(self, ownerDoc):
     BaseStructuralNode.__init__(self, ownerDoc, 'svg')
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     ConditionalProcessingAttributes.__init__(self)
     DocumentEventAttributes.__init__(self)
     #add the groups
     self._allowedSvgChildNodes.update(self.SVG_GROUP_ANIMATION_ELEMENTS, self.SVG_GROUP_DESCRIPTIVE_ELEMENTS,
                                       self.SVG_GROUP_SHAPE_ELEMENTS, self.SVG_GROUP_STRUCTURAL_ELEMENTS,
                                       self.SVG_GROUP_GRADIENT_ELEMENTS)
     #add the individual nodes
     self._allowedSvgChildNodes.update(
         {self.SVG_A_NODE, self.SVG_ALT_GLYPH_DEF_NODE, self.SVG_CLIP_PATH_NODE, self.SVG_COLOR_PROFILE_NODE,
          self.SVG_CURSOR_NODE, self.SVG_FILTER_NODE,
          self.SVG_FONT_NODE, self.SVG_FONT_FACE_NODE, self.SVG_FOREIGN_OBJECT_NODE, self.SVG_IMAGE_NODE,
          self.SVG_MARKER_NODE, self.SVG_MASK_NODE, self.SVG_PATTERN_NODE,
          self.SVG_SCRIPT_NODE, self.SVG_STYLE_NODE, self.SVG_SWITCH_NODE, self.SVG_TEXT_NODE, self.SVG_VIEW_NODE
         })
Exemplo n.º 21
0
 def __init__(self):
     BasicSvgA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
 def __init__(self):
     BasicSvgAttribute.__init__(self)
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
Exemplo n.º 23
0
 def __init__(self, ownerDoc):
     BaseTextNode.__init__(self, ownerDoc, 'altGlyph')
     XlinkAttributes.__init__(self)
     PositionAttributes.__init__(self)
     self.allowAllSvgNodesAsChildNodes= True
Exemplo n.º 24
0
 def __init__(self, ownerDoc):
     BaseStructuralNode.__init__(self, ownerDoc, 'use')
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     ConditionalProcessingAttributes.__init__(self)
Exemplo n.º 25
0
 def __init__(self, ownerDoc):
     BaseStructuralNode.__init__(self, ownerDoc, 'use')
     PositionAttributes.__init__(self)
     SizeAttributes.__init__(self)
     ConditionalProcessingAttributes.__init__(self)
Exemplo n.º 26
0
 def __init__(self, ownerDoc):
     BaseTextNode.__init__(self, ownerDoc, 'altGlyph')
     XlinkAttributes.__init__(self)
     PositionAttributes.__init__(self)
     self.allowAllSvgNodesAsChildNodes = True